Se um computador estiver conectado à Internet via rede sem fio e LAN, qual o fluxo de tráfego da Internet?

10

Como isso realmente funciona? Como diferentes endereços IP no adaptador Ethernet e no adaptador sem fio são tratados para dados da Internet? Eu sei que esses ip são traduzidos na tabela NAT, mas todo o processo envolvendo Ethernet e adaptador sem fio juntos não está claro para mim.

whitequark
fonte
2
isso não está programando-relacionados, e deverá ser transferido para superuser.com
pixeline
1
Na minha experiência, se você tem um aplicativo aberto através do sistema sem fio, conecta uma conexão com fio e abre um novo aplicativo, pode usar os dois, mas espero que dependa do SO nesse momento.
James Black
@ James: funciona exatamente dessa maneira no Linux, usado algumas vezes para baixar grandes arquivos através da LAN e WLAN.
whitequark

Respostas:

8

Se o destino (para o pacote enviado pela sua máquina) não estiver na LAN ( DestAddress & Netmask != YourLANAddress & Netmask), ele será redirecionado para o gateway padrão e se os dois dispositivos estiverem conectados à mesma rede (se houver endereços IP pertencentes à mesma rede) ; é determinado pelo mesmo algoritmo) o pacote passará pelo dispositivo com uma métrica mais baixa .

whitequark
fonte
Isso é interessante. Você pode elaborar mais sobre o assunto das métricas? Como eles são configurados, por padrão, entre os adaptadores sem fio e LAN? Ou eles são configurados dinamicamente pelo sistema operacional após identificar o caminho mais rápido?
precisa saber é
AFAIK todos os adaptadores de rede 'reais' (por exemplo, não TAP ou loopback) obtêm a mesma métrica; e o sistema operacional nunca faria esse teste de velocidade pelo menos porque não pode confiar em algum host externo para ser o segundo ponto de extremidade de medição.
fácil
sem usar o sinal @, nunca poderia ver você "responder" ao meu comentário, a menos que eu viesse aqui, como acidentalmente fiz. agora nem me lembro o que eu quis dizer! : P
cregox 21/09/10
@ Cayas: bem, eu não sabia sobre o recurso @ naquela época. :)
whitequark
3

É totalmente dependente de como suas interfaces de rede estão configuradas. O local usual em que isso é feito é em uma tabela de roteamento , que lista os endereços Ethernet dos nós adjacentes. Ambos podem ser usados ​​ao mesmo tempo, ou apenas um, dependendo do que esta tabela diz.

Por exemplo, em uma dessas configurações no MacOSX, consulte minha pergunta aqui: Como posso saber qual interface de rede meu computador está usando?

Éter
fonte
0

Acredito que um dos dispositivos esteja definido como um dispositivo 'padrão'. O outro basicamente fica sentado e não faz nada. Clique duas vezes no pequeno ícone da bandeja da sua conexão à Internet, ele informará qual está usando ...

IAbstract
fonte
0

Da minha experiência no Windows XP (de ter os ícones de atividade de rede na área de notificação), parece inteligente o suficiente para usar a conexão LAN mais rápida assim que estiver disponível. Ligue os ícones e veja por si mesmo.

user13141
fonte